What Low AMH Means for Families in OMR Sholinganallur
Anti-Müllerian Hormone is produced by the small follicles in your ovaries, and its level in the blood gives fertility specialists a reliable estimate of how many eggs you have remaining — your ovarian reserve. When AMH is low, it signals that the pool of available eggs is smaller than average for your age, which can make natural conception harder and may affect how your ovaries respond to fertility medications.

It is important to understand, however, that AMH is a quantity marker, not a quality marker. A lower egg count does not automatically mean lower egg quality — and egg quality remains the single most important factor in achieving a healthy pregnancy.

or chat on WhatsApp →Medical Decision Drivers: When Is IVF the Right Choice for Low AMH?
Not every woman with a low AMH reading needs to proceed directly to IVF. The HomeIVF Medical Board evaluates several factors before recommending a treatment pathway.
Age is the primary driver. A woman under 35 with mildly low AMH (0.5-1.0 ng/mL) and open fallopian tubes may be advised to try ovulation induction with intrauterine insemination (IUI) for two to three cycles before escalating to IVF. However, if AMH is below 0.5 ng/mL — often called very low or diminished ovarian reserve — or if the woman is over 37, most evidence supports moving directly to IVF to make the best use of the remaining egg pool.
Poor ovarian response to prior stimulation is another signal. If a previous IVF cycle yielded fewer than three mature eggs despite adequate dosing, protocols such as the Bologna criteria classify this as poor ovarian response. In such cases, the HomeIVF Medical Board may recommend adjunct strategies: DHEA supplementation for 60-90 days prior to stimulation, growth hormone co-treatment, or dual stimulation (DuoStim) in the same cycle to retrieve eggs from both the follicular and luteal phases.
IVF success rates in India typically range from 40-55% per cycle depending on age and the underlying cause of infertility. Women with low AMH but good egg quality — especially those under 35 — often achieve outcomes within this range when treated with an individualised, low-dose, quality-focused protocol.

What does AMH below 1.0 ng/mL mean for my fertility in Sholinganallur?+
An AMH below 1.0 ng/mL generally indicates a lower-than-average ovarian reserve for your age. It means your ovaries may produce fewer eggs in response to stimulation, but it does not mean zero eggs or zero chance of pregnancy. How do I know if I need IVF or IUI for low AMH in Sholinganallur Chennai?+
The decision depends on several factors: your exact AMH level, age, fallopian tube status, partner sperm parameters, and how long you have been trying to conceive. Women under 35 with mildly low AMH and open tubes may be candidates for IUI first. Women over 37 or with AMH below 0.5 ng/mL are usually advised to proceed directly to IVF to make the most of the available egg reserve.
